Transaction d4b84450fc9c1d22f7330ac66fb3a75275dba930fb24caf29ec638dd38252b3b

116 Input
2 Outputs
  • d4b84450fc9c1d22f7330ac66fb3a75275dba930fb24caf29ec638dd38252b3b:0
  • value  2138797560
    address  3QhLSph7xbWWdeJpriabPhBNvq5QZ5RLMf
  • d4b84450fc9c1d22f7330ac66fb3a75275dba930fb24caf29ec638dd38252b3b:1
  • value  1041092
    address  3Hz9PwWXBTw6xu7wMSfuhbHYVRPtdmrmvt